Why Are Military-Grade Pneumatic Cylinders So Different From Standard Models?

Military-grade pneumatic cylinders are engineered to withstand extreme conditions through specialized designs that meet rigorous standards like GJB150.18 shock testing (requiring survival of 100g acceleration pulses), EMI shielding enclosures that provide 80-100dB of electromagnetic interference protection, and comprehensive “three-proof” coating systems that resist salt spray for 1,000+ hours while maintaining functionality in temperature ranges from -55°C to +125°C.

How Do Rodless Pneumatic Cylinders Actually Work?

Rodless pneumatic cylinders work by transferring force through either magnetic coupling or mechanical joints sealed within a cylinder tube. When compressed air enters one chamber, it creates pressure that moves an internal piston, which then transfers motion to an external carriage through these coupling mechanisms, all while maintaining the pneumatic seal.

How Do Physics Laws Govern Pneumatic Cylinder Performance?

Pneumatic cylinders operate according to fundamental physics principles, primarily Pascal’s Law, which states that pressure applied to a confined fluid is transmitted equally in all directions. This allows us to calculate cylinder force by multiplying pressure by the effective piston area, with flow rates and pressure units requiring precise conversions for accurate system design.
